How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fort Lauderdale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fort Lauderdale Studio Apartments | $2,075 | $750 | $4,314 |
| Fort Lauderdale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,482 | $1,175 | $6,639 |
| Fort Lauderdale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,194 | $221 | $10,000+ |
| Fort Lauderdale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,083 | $1,635 | $10,000+ |
| Fort Lauderdale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,304 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
